Fill your heart with light
A big part of living a joyful life is intentionally cultivating positive experiences and taking time to absorb them into your body and your brain. You can do that in your yoga practice by closely monitoring your experience during asana, by maintaining deep consistent breathing pace, and by using simple inspirational imagery. Images from nature work especially well because they evoke similar feelings you get when you are out in nature.
This short yoga practice evokes the image of sunlight and uses a line from the song Light and Day by The Polyphonic Spree as a chant. It invites you to “Follow the day and reach for the sun!” This practice is useful any time you feel guarded or timid. It will energize your body, help you breathe deeper and encourage you to be a bit more open and courageous.
